Cal Newport is a professor of computer science at Georgetown University. Newport is concerned for the future generation about how their concentration could be reduced. Newport stated, “when you take large portions of your day checking social media that this can permanently reduce your capacity for concentration.” This is showing how addictive social media can be and show that social media addiction can affect you in a massive way.
Steven Kotler is a American author, journalist, and entrepreneur. Kotler is concerned that social media is addictive as drugs and kids have easy access to it. Kotler says, “we are essentially putting highly addictive drugs in the hand of kids.” Kotler is saying that social media is so addictive you can compare it to drugs and that is something that is scary to think of and this points to the overall message of this media.
Chamath Palihapitiya is a venture capitalist and the founder of Social Capital. Palihapitiya is concerned that social media can ruin peoples behavior. Palihapitiya said that “social media is eroding the core foundations of how people behave.” He says this because it can be so addictive it can ruin how people behave toward you and it might even ruin friendships and ruin lives because people try to mock others on social media that show one little part of their life.
